NCDC Friday Final Scores | Nov. 1, 2025

NCDC_Friday_Final

New York Dynamo 1, Boston Jr. Rangers 5
Jack O’Connor, Adam Bauer, Sam Luan and Jacob Gelman powered the Rangers’ offense in a strong home win. Luc Cloutier scored for New York.

Boston Junior Bruins 5, South Shore Kings 2
Simon Mateas and Colin Ward each scored twice for the Junior Bruins, who used a three-goal second period to pull away.

West Chester Wolves 3, Rockets Hockey Club 8
Jakub Kristek, Brady Wilson and Ruben Stone led a high-powered Rockets attack, scoring four in the first and never looking back. Colin Murphy and Dallas Glenn scored for the Wolves.

Utica Jr. Comets 3, Thunder Hockey Club 0
Carson Zick scored a pair and Zach Groleau added one as Utica blanked Thunder.

Connecticut Junior Rangers 5, P.A.L. Jr. Islanders 2 (SO)
Ralfs Veidemanis scored twice in regulation and Egor Sapozhnikov netted the shootout winner for Connecticut.

St. Stephen County Moose 1, Woodstock NB Slammers 4
Ryley Callan and Brandon Meyers helped pace the Slammers, who scored once in each period.

CT Chiefs North 6, Northern Maine Pioneers 3
Nikolay Kharinov and Albert Gervais each scored in a four-goal third period that lifted the Chiefs.

Lewiston MAINEiacs 4, Universel Academy 2
Aidan Palmeter struck twice in the third as the MAINEiacs sealed the win.

Pueblo Bulls 2, Utah Outliers 1 (SO)
Brody Clarke tied it late and Benjamin Taylor won it in the shootout for Pueblo.

Casper Warbirds 2, Idaho Falls Spud Kings 4
Daniel Macleish and Braden Cunningham scored back-to-back in the second to push Idaho Falls in front for good.

Rock Springs Miners 3, Grand Junction River Hawks 2
Ryan Moise and Anderson Sandquist scored in the second to help the Miners edge GJRH. Rock Springs netminder Nolan Francis was great as he stopped 32 of 34 shots for a .941 SV% in the win.
